Phil Jackson's Net Worth: How Much Is the NBA Legend Worth?

Phil Jackson is widely regarded as one of the most successful coaches in NBA history, with earnings derived from decades of championships and endorsement work. His net worth reflects both sustained basketball income and savvy financial decisions beyond the hardwood.

By examining key career phases, coaching salaries, business ventures, and post-NBA opportunities, it becomes clearer how Jackson built and maintained his substantial wealth.

Coaching Earnings and Championships Influence

Coaching salaries during Jackson’s Bulls and Lakers years formed the backbone of his net worth. Championship runs drove larger bonuses and contract extensions, allowing him to command premium fees in each new agreement.

His long-term relationships with franchise owners meant consistent raises and performance incentives. Over more than twenty seasons as an NBA head coach, these escalating earnings compounded into a sizable net worth.

How much did Phil Jackson earn per year at his peak coaching salaries?

At his peak with the Los Angeles Lakers, Phil Jackson’s annual salary exceeded ten million dollars, often including performance bonuses tied to championships.
